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an: the times of struggles

Posted by Sushma Shrestha On December 24, 2014

KYY

MTV's popular youth based show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an is going on a high note about the youth aspirations, struggles to achieve ambitions and significance of strong determination and friendship all the way on the regard. Pleasantly, the show at present is at its motivational best for the youngsters that follow the show on a regular basis and are crazy to explore more of it. Here is Just Showbiz, presenting you all, an exclusive review of the ongoing track of the show. Without further ado, let'sget into the current highlights of the show.

Starting with the good points, the obvious best part of the ongoing track is, the portrayal of inevitable and enthusiastic connect of youth with aspiration. "Music is my life" the dedication of Fab 5 lead Manik Malhotra (Parth Samthaan) is showcased in the show as strong and appealing as it deserves. As the add up factor, the rest of the Fab 5 members' zest to grab the big opportunity to reach somewhere in the music field and support to Manik's determination of performing despite him being unable to perform with fractured hand is truly commendable. One can experience the "real" bond of a heartwarming friendship built amongst the five friends which is just fabulous just like the name of their music band- Fab 5.

5 friends

As much as the story is about the friendship and music band, we can't let the individual stories of the leads heading parallel to the mainstream story go unnoticed. Hence, the second noteworthy point to be mentioned about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an is that the show has numerous parallel tracks moving on precisely, which enhances the quality of the script writing and makes it all the more rich content bearing.

Thirdly, the highlight of the show is performances by the actors. Lead actor Parth Samthaan stands out as the heady, arrogant, young and confused Manik Malhotra out shining rest of the cast. His performance is truly entertaining and keeps us glued at the screens while he is in there. Kishwar Merchant carries the role of Nyonica Malhotra, Manik's mother- a grey shaded, ambitious and shrewd lady, with natural ease so much like her other television roles so far. Another special mention goes to Ayaz Ahemad for playing Cabir, a gay member of Fab 5 and Abhisek Malik who plays the role of Harshad, despicable baddie of the story. Both the actors have been doing their roles justifiably well. The other three Fab 5 mates are just fine while Vheeba Anand and rest supporting cast are just about fit in their roles, given the lesser scopes to them.

Now moving on with the weaker aspects, performance wise lead actress Niti Taylor, as Nandini, is not that well convincing or say doesn't go down well at par with the other major leads. Undoubtedly, she has improved than the initial days, still it feels she needs more grooming, appropriate voice modulation, dialogue clarity and rather better set of emotive expressions. Chemistry shared by her and Parth is one of the good ones of current times, for which rather the abundant number of physical romantic scenes and underneath script lines with respect to such scenes should be better counted for than Niti's romance enactment. Many a times, her expressions make the scenes look a bit forced and uncomfortable.

Kiss

Secondly, on the love story part the "seperation" or "tiff" or "confusion" betweenNandini and Manik has started appearing over stretched or somewhat dragged. An exceptional factor is surely missing in the tale of their love as the writers seem to have given to the cliche of usual love-hate confusion sorta drama. Moreover, indulging a friend to make the lead hero come out to the relationship dilemma makes it even more cliched.

Not to forget here, the new entry in Manik and Nandini's life, supposedly the next third angle in their love, fails to make a significant mark. On a side note, she can be the "matter of distress" as usual for fans of the show.

In the meantime, the show initially advertised as an adaptation of famous Japanese/Korean drama series "Boys Over Flowers" is quite distinct in story line and execution than the original show, except for its base story set up. However, if you are an ardent Korean shows follower and have gone through many of the Korean musical love stories (given that there is overwhelming Korean wave of such love dramas throughout Asian countries), from the past decade, you will find a lot of similar lines from such shows in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an. In short, the creative of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an seem much inspired by Korean wave; which can be taken as not-so-good-point for the show's upcoming development. However, if parallel stories are to be stringed meticulously and in enunciating way, such inspiration can't be taken as a harmful factor to the story. Coming to the technical execution of the show, execution of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an is not at a never seen before level, rather, it lacks the extravagant show or exquisite scenery as spoken in the script. Well! We can say, we have seen better shot- sequences and technical execution in other shows beforehand.

To conclude, the ongoing track on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an is somewhat conventional, above average and convenient storytelling, which in turn holds a promise of better development in coming days. Filled with some finest performances of small screen, side by side unearthing of the motivational story of an ordinary music band's quest for stardom and also several relational strings hanging to be tied properly, it is definitely the times for struggles in(for)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an. Nonetheless, a good entertainer that can provide a light-hearted fun as well as young vibes, we suggest you to list Kaisi Yeh Yaariyan in your "to watch" TV series list, if you are not already following it.
